摘要
Due to its high capacity,silicon based anode materials have been widely studied in recent years.The insertion/interinsertion lithium-ion principle of silicon anode for lithium-ion battery is mainly analyzed,the latest alleviation methods of cracking and crushing of the silicon are reviewed,and the shortcoming of these methods is also pre-sented.With the advantage of high conductivity,high elastic,porous,high stability,polypyrrole compouded with silicon will be the most promising developing direction to improve the cycle stability of silicon-based anode materials in lithium-ion battery.
